How to book the cheapest flight to New Market?
Snapping up cheap flights to New Market is as simple as booking with Orbitz. But if you want to make sure you're walking away with the best flight deals around, here are a few tips worth following:

  • Taking off from or landing at other airports can sometimes save you money. Enter your preferred departure and arrival airports. Next, click on the 'Nearby airports' function below to explore your options.
  • Similarly, click on the 'Show flexible dates' link to view the prices for days around your chosen departure. It's possible to find cheaper flight deals if your travel plans are flexible.
  • You can also select the 'Show options' link to filter results for your preferred carrier, seating class, nonstop flights and refundable flights. Under 'Sort & Filter' to the left, you can even pick the time of day you want to fly.
  • The early bird gets the best savings, so book as soon as you know your travel dates. The most affordable airfares go like hotcakes and prices generally rise as the departure date nears.
  • Bundle your hotels, flights and car rentals into an impressive package deal. Save your dollars for things you're really excited about, like exploring New Market.
  • Flying during peak season means steep airfares. Try to avoid traveling over popular periods, such as Christmas, New Year's Eve and Easter.

What do I need for the flight to New Market?
There's nothing like flying somewhere new, but it pays to be prepared. This list of top tips will help get your journey off to a flying start:

  • Whether you print it out beforehand or use an electronic one, you'll need your boarding pass to get on to the plane. You'll also need some type of government-issued ID. If you're flying internationally, make sure your passport is valid.
  • Make time fly by even faster on your short flight by packing the right gear. Think yummy snacks, bottled water and entertainment. If you want your trip to New Market to pass nice and quietly, squeeze some noise-canceling headphones or earplugs into your carry-on bag as well.
  • No matter what the temperature is doing outside, plane cabins can get cold. Bring a light jacket on board to keep yourself warm and cozy.

How do I get cheap first-class/business deals to New Market?
If you think a business or first-class fare is out of your reach, think again. Here are some practical tips to help you land a premium flight to New Market for less:

  • Be flexible. By being open to a few travel dates, you'll have better odds of spotting a sale on your airfares.
  • Look for a low-cost carrier that has seats in business class. They often come with extra legroom and a glass of Champagne — but at a more affordable price.
  • Bid for an upgrade in online auctions (if available) or upgrade your seat through your flight loyalty scheme.
